16.3.7. VIP를 사용하여 IP Failover 구성
선택적으로 관리자는 IP 페일오버를 구성할 수 있습니다.
IP 페일오버는 노드 집합에서 VIP(가상 IP) 주소 풀을 관리합니다. 세트의 모든 VIP는 세트에서 선택한 노드에서 서비스를 제공합니다. 단일 노드를 사용할 수 있는 경우 VIP가 제공됩니다. 노드에 VIP를 명시적으로 배포할 수 있는 방법은 없습니다. 따라서 VIP가 없는 노드와 여러 VIP가 있는 다른 노드가 있을 수 있습니다. 노드가 하나만 있는 경우 모든 VIP가 노드에 있습니다.
VIP는 클러스터 외부에서 라우팅할 수 있어야 합니다.
IP 페일오버를 구성하려면 다음을 수행합니다.
마스터에서
ipfailover
서비스 계정에 충분한 보안 권한이 있는지 확인합니다.oc adm policy add-scc-to-user privileged -z ipfailover
다음 명령을 실행하여 IP 페일오버를 생성합니다.
oc adm ipfailover --virtual-ips=<exposed-ip-address> --watch-port=<exposed-port> --replicas=<number-of-pods> --create
예를 들어 다음과 같습니다.
oc adm ipfailover --virtual-ips="172.30.233.169" --watch-port=32315 --replicas=4 --create --> Creating IP failover ipfailover ... serviceaccount "ipfailover" created deploymentconfig "ipfailover" created --> Success